介绍根据星敏感器同时观测几颗恒星的方向信息,用最小二乘法确定飞行器姿态的经典Wehba问题。针对用四元数描述飞行器姿态的情况,推导了的一种解析算法。观测5颗恒星实例的仿真结果表明,该算法能保证飞行器体轴系相对惯性系姿态的高精度。
According to the star sensor observing the direction information of several stars at the same time, the least square method is used to determine the classical Wehba problem of aircraft attitude. Aiming at the problem of using quaternion to describe aircraft attitude, an analytical algorithm is derived. The simulation results of observing five star examples show that the algorithm can ensure the high accuracy of relative inertial attitude of the body axis of the aircraft.
